Though Appley Bridge lacks a ticket office, worry not, as ticket machines are available for collecting your tickets. It’s worth noting that while you can collect your tickets directly from these machines, they are not accessible for everyone. An induction loop is in place to assist those with hearing difficulties. Despite the absence of smartcard facilities, the absence of ticket barriers ensures easy platform access.
The station offers partial step-free access. This convenience, coupled with the presence of boarding ramps on trains, ensures passengers with mobility issues are well catered for. However, it’s advisable to check the detailed route layout via the 360 map for more accessible route options.
While there are no staff members to assist, a helpline is available if help is needed. CCTV is operational, and seating areas are available for your comfort. Keep in mind that neither toilets nor refreshment facilities are available, so plan accordingly before your trip. There are 15 free parking spaces, but none are designated for disabled access, so do plan accordingly.
If you’re planning to continue your journey from Appley Bridge Station, several travel options are at your disposal. While there are no local bus services directly from the station itself, buses for rail replacement services can be found at the nearby station approach on Appley Lane North. For those looking to book a taxi, relevant services can be accessed through the Northern Railway website. It's advised to arrange these services ahead of your visit.
No bicycle hire facilities are present, though cycle storage is available for personal bikes. Five bicycle lockers are within the car park, equipped with CCTV, providing a secure option for cycling enthusiasts.

When visiting Knutsford Train Station, you'll find several essential amenities to assist with your journey. The station operates a well-timed ticket office that opens early and closes late: Monday to Friday from 06:30 to 20:30, Saturday from 07:00 to 19:30, and Sunday from 12:10 to 19:40. For convenience, there are ticket machines available, including accessible ones, as well as facilities to collect tickets purchased online. Accessibility features are integrated into the station’s layout. Designated as a Category B Station, there is step-free access to some areas, with separate level entrances for platforms heading towards Chester and Manchester.
If you require additional support, staff assistance is available from Monday, 06:30 to 20:00. Additionally, there is an induction loop for the hearing impaired, and a ramp is available for train access. While there are no waiting rooms, passengers can find ample seating areas on the platforms.
Moving beyond the station, Knutsford provides multiple onward travel options. If your journey requires rail replacement services, pick-up and drop-off points are conveniently located at bus stops on Adams Hill. For those seeking local taxi services, details are accessible via Northern Railway's taxi information page. Buses are also a viable option, with connections available through Traveline at 0871 200 2233. Cyclists would need to look elsewhere for bicycle hire as this facility is not available at the station.
